- Notfalling4itIt is a SCAM. There is no need to the afraid. Don't ever give people who call you from a suspicious phone number any information about your accounts or your personal business. Sometimes, they will leave you a message saying they are from Symphony Bank, or similar financial institution (who represent various stores and take care of receiving payments from customers when they have used a credit card). Because I have the visual voicemail app, I READ the message instead of listening to it, therefore NOT exposing myself to the "Creep Factor". The VVM didn't say WHAT store's credit card they were calling about, and THAT was another RED FLAG!
So, Don't get upset!
Just block the number, or, add it to the "auto reject" list. Call your phone company or cell phone carrier and ask a representative how to do this if you do not know how. So, When the 10000000000 number showed up, it didn't feel right, correct? Trust your GUT on these things!
The advice is usually to NOT answer it.
However, If you DID answer it, don't let it steal a moment of your peace. You WILL NOT be abducted by aliens, OR spontaneously combust! It's more difficult for them to get your personal information if you are NOT speaking to them. That's all. Remember, millions of people get these type of calls. It doesn't mean that a psycho is zeroing in on you.
You can do this..You are stronger than you think!
